The Senior Investment Analyst, Mutual Funds, serves in a lead role in the management of the VantageTrust Trust Series Funds, in consultation with the Mutual Funds Research Team. Requires broad and deep analysis and due diligence on the individual funds, while also ensuring that the funds as a group continue to serve the purpose of providing a diversified set of mutual funds in ICMA-RC’s standard lineup. The Senior Investment Analyst also serves as a member of the Research Team’s effort as it relates to open architecture funds. The position is also involved in the management of various projects, such as strategic initiatives, thought leadership, board reporting, compliance and other communications.
Essential functions for this role include:
• Management of Trust Series Funds
◦ Perform both qualitative and quantitative analysis on funds, utilizing state of the art analytical software tools.
◦ Perform due diligence on existing funds through meetings with senior executives of fund firms.
◦ Monitor asset managers’ adherence to objectives and investment strategies.
◦ Stay updated on the financial markets, the economy, securities in general and specific emphasis on holdings impacting the funds and their performance.
◦ Provide significant input on the hiring and termination process for funds.
◦ Develop effective relationships with and perform due diligence on prospective asset managers.
◦ Review, write, and as needed, present routine and ad hoc information on certain funds and their asset managers for different reporting needs. Examples include information for internal groups/divisions, committee meetings, board reports, clients and consultants.
• Serve as key member of the Investment Division Research Team in conducting research.
◦ Conduct research and participate in fund interviews to determine appropriateness of including funds in our Select List or for use in changing client lineups.
◦ Conduct manager research in support of developing a bench of managers for investment product created by ICMA-RC’s Investment Division.
◦ Conduct macroeconomic and market research in support of the Investment Division’s goals including but not limited to thought leadership, client communication and internal education.
• Assist in developing and implementing fund lineup changes.
◦ Conduct research to support and help determine optimal lineup structures and funds, and as instructed, implement fund changes working with asset managers and different groups within the Corporation.
• Assist in the management of various projects, such as strategic initiatives, board reporting, compliance and other communications. Activities include:
◦ Assisting in analysis or due diligence in support of the Corporation’s proprietary portfolios.
◦ Supporting marketing, sales or other communications efforts through research, analysis, written reports, “request for proposal” reviews/responses utilizing specific investment knowledge.
